    Is the initial SF training pipeline with the Guard the same as an active duty 18X contract? I've looked it up online but have been told conflicting things as to whether the Special Operations Prep Course is included with the Guard. If not, is it possible to request SOPC in the Guard prior to SFAS?

    I'm prior service and was told that I would reenlist into my primary MOS, request to drill with an SF unit, and then after 3 months they would decide whether or not to send me to selection. I would like to go to OSUT as well and was wondering if this is possible to request as prior service?

    I believe SOPC attendance depends on the state. I know for awhile, TXARNG was sending their prior service guys to SOPC. I believe just about everybody else will keep you in their pre-SFAS program until they are confident that you are ready for selection. Meaning that you will be doing SOPC like training in your drills until they feel you are ready. At this point attending SOPC is a moot point.

    If you were not prior service, the REP63 program does mirror the 18X program. You would attend 11B OSUT, then Airborne, SOPC, SFAS etc..

    Best option is to contact the SF Recruiter/Accessions NCO for the state you are interested in and start from there.

    As prior service you cannot directly enlist for Special Forces in the Guard. Yes you would have to reenlist in either your former MOS or reclass to one that is available within the state. Then you would request and schedule to attend the SF unit's readiness evaluation (SFRE), basically a unit try-out. If you pass and the unit likes what you have to offer, then they will work with you to send you to SFAS.
    Most units will not send you to SOPC/SFPC. That is usually reserved for non-prior service.
